Kosher Salt Market, Segmentation by Product Type
The Product Type segmentation identifies the different forms of kosher salt, each of which serves specific uses in culinary and food processing applications. The choice of product type influences its suitability for different applications based on texture, size, and dissolving properties.
Fine
Fine kosher salt has smaller crystals, making it ideal for seasoning and quick dissolving in dishes. It is widely used in restaurants, kitchens, and packaged food products where consistent flavor distribution is important.
Flake
Flake kosher salt is prized for its delicate texture and ability to provide a light, crunchy finish. Its larger, irregularly shaped flakes make it a popular choice for garnishing dishes, especially in high-end culinary applications and gourmet food products.
Coarse
Coarse kosher salt has large, crystalline grains that are commonly used in meat and poultry processing, as well as in brining applications. This product type is valued for its ability to draw out moisture from meat, enhancing the flavor and texture of food products.
Kosher Salt Market, Segmentation by Application
The Application segmentation identifies the primary industries and food categories that drive the demand for kosher salt. Kosher salt’s unique properties make it suitable for a wide range of applications in food preparation, preservation, and seasoning.
Meat & Poultry Processing
Meat & Poultry Processing is one of the largest application segments for kosher salt. The coarse texture of kosher salt is ideal for curing and brining meat, helping to preserve its freshness and enhance its flavor. This segment benefits from the growing demand for processed meats and ready-to-eat products.
Seasonings & Marinades
Seasonings & Marinades use kosher salt as a key ingredient for flavor enhancement. The ability of kosher salt to dissolve easily and evenly makes it a favorite in marinades and seasoning blends, particularly in the preparation of gourmet dishes and premium food products.
Sauces & Condiments
Sauces & Condiments applications use kosher salt to balance flavors and enhance the taste profile of various sauces, dressings, and dips. Its clean taste and easy dissolving nature make it suitable for both commercial food manufacturing and home-cooked meals.
Baking
Baking is another significant application for kosher salt. It is often used in bread and pastry production to regulate yeast activity, enhance flavor, and improve the texture of baked goods. The presence of kosher salt in premium breads and artisan products is driving demand in this segment.

Rising Demand-The Global Kosher Salt Market is witnessing rising demand driven by several factors, including its culinary versatility and perceived health benefits. Kosher salt, known for its larger grain size and lack of additives like iodine, has gained popularity among chefs and home cooks alike for its ability to enhance flavors and textures of dishes without imparting a metallic taste. This market growth is also supported by increasing consumer preference for natural and unprocessed food products, aligning with broader health and wellness trends.
Kosher salt's designation as kosher-certified appeals to consumers seeking products that meet specific dietary or cultural requirements. This certification ensures that the salt meets strict production standards under rabbinical supervision, which adds to its appeal in both Jewish and non-Jewish communities.
